Abstract—
The development of high-intensity extractors operating in the pre-emulsion mode is a promising task in the field of extraction of d- and f-elements. The paper presents a microcontactor in which it is possible to extract 20% REE in 34 s of phase contact from the original amount taken. The influence of the composition of the extraction system, the nature of the solvent and REE, and the initial conditions of the process on the mass-transfer coefficient is established. The dependence of the Sherwood number on the Reynolds and Prandtl numbers is obtained. The results of the work can be useful in the creation of new extractors operating in the pre-emulsion mode.
